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Men and women 18-89 y/o
  • Non-contrast Computed Tomography (NCCT)- or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I)- verified, previously unoperated uni- or bilateral cSDH
  • Clinical and/or radiological status indicating neurosurgical treatment
  • Markwalder Scale score \<2
  • Glasgow coma Scale score \>13
  • Able to provide signed informed consent

Exclusion

  • Acute subdural hematoma
  • Focal, non-hemispheric cSDH
  • Midline shift \>10 mm and/or effaced basal cisterns and/or significant dilatation of one or both lateral ventricle temporal horns and/or incipient uncal herniation
  • Structural pathology causing the cSDH (e.g. dural AV-fistula, AVM, tumor, arachnoid cyst, ventriculoperitoneal shunt)
  • Contraindications to angiography
  • Dependency defined as mRS \>3
  • Life expectancy \<6 months
  • Comorbidity deemed making follow up impossible
  • Participation in other interventional clinical study
  • Pregnancy
